‘Is this the man?’

An unwavering expression, and a powerful aura.

However, Mo Ja-Seon was greatly surprised.

‘This man is the pinnacle of the martial world, known as the Black and White Emperor.’

While there might be those who surpass him in raw power, his influence was said to be unmatched, not just in this era but throughout history. That was the reputation of the Black and White Emperor, Yeon Ho-Jeong.

His fame was so great that even before he entered the mainland, the four characters of his title, ‘Black and White Emperor,’ were occasionally heard.

‘I heard he was young, but…’

She didn’t know his exact age. Her focus had been on the achievements and influence of the master known as the Black and White Emperor, not his age.

Still, she knew he was young. But she hadn’t expected him to be this young. He looked to be around thirty at most, yet he exuded such extraordinary energy.

‘He’s different.’

Tall and slender.

By the standards of the Ice Palace, his skin wasn’t pale, but it was very smooth and supple. Combined with the mystical aura that only those who had reached the highest realms could display, he had a presence that would captivate anyone.

However, Mo Ja-Seon could see the brutal power lurking beneath that mystical aura.

‘He’s so different from what I vaguely imagined.’

The martial arts of the Northern Sea and those of the mainland were similar yet different.

However, when one reached the highest realms, many commonalities would appear even between those who had trained in completely different martial arts.

Mo Ja-Seon could find no such commonalities in Yeon Ho-Jeong.

‘But one thing is certain…’

Within her loose sleeves, Mo Ja-Seon’s slender fingers clenched tightly.

‘This man is a warrior.’

And not just any warrior.

A veteran who had survived countless battles, making a hundred battles seem like nothing. His achieved level was astonishing, but even more surprising was the warrior’s aura hidden within his mystical energy. She couldn’t fathom what kind of life this young man, who appeared to be around thirty, had lived to display such chilling composure.

“I thought I’d never meet someone like you in my life, but fate has brought us together in this way.”

Why was it?

Mo Ja-Seon thought Yeon Ho-Jeong’s voice was very pleasant to listen to.

With his hands behind his back, Yeon Ho-Jeong walked step by step towards the river. With each step, the Black Dragon Hand Axe dangling from his waist made a clanking sound.

“You wanted to see me?”

Yeon Ho-Jeong’s tone was straightforward. He didn’t use honorifics, even though she was much older than him.

In truth, considering his past life, he had lived to the twilight of his years, but he wasn’t making such remarks because of his age.

This was about status.

Yeon Ho-Jeong knew that his status was in no way inferior to his opponent’s.

A faint smile appeared on Mo Ja-Seon’s face.

It was an awkward smile, like that of the Palace Lord, Mo Ung-Baek. That made it feel all the more sincere.

“You already knew about me.”

“The moment you entered the Central Plains, all sorts of intelligence organizations began watching you.”

Yeon Ho-Jeong still didn’t turn to look at Mo Ja-Seon.

Looking at the lapping river under the dark sky, he felt a rather unique sense of emotion.

“Impressive. Your martial arts are similar to ours yet completely different. It might not matter much now that you’ve reached that level, but if your subordinates and mine were to fight, there would be some bloodshed.”

“Are you assuming we will fight?”

“I don’t have a hobby of smiling at people only to get stabbed in the back.”

Yeon Ho-Jeong’s voice was firm yet very comfortable to listen to. Even though it was a rather tense situation, even Gang Ryang could sense that Yeon Ho-Jeong’s voice had changed slightly.

His words were harsh, but his voice was so calm that it didn’t create a sharp atmosphere. It was a mysterious ability.

Mo Ja-Seon, who had been quietly watching Yeon Ho-Jeong, took a step forward.

It was then.

Swoosh.

The Black Dragon Hand Axe revealed itself.

His voice had been calm, and the atmosphere had been pleasant. But with that one action, even the sound of the lapping river seemed to disappear.

Mo Ja-Seon asked bluntly,

“What does this mean?”

Whoooosh.

A cold aura rose from Mo Ja-Seon’s body.

It wasn’t that she had released her energy intentionally. The moment her opponent drew his weapon, she felt tension, and that tension naturally released her inherent nature.

Swoosh.

Gang Ryang and the Dragon Corps naturally retreated ten paces.

Their posture was relaxed yet provocative. They were ready to draw their swords at any moment upon command.

They had come here smiling together, but the moment their lord gave the order, any personal ties would become less than burnt paper. They were prepared to attack Mo Ja-Seon at any time.

Mo Ja-Seon, after looking at Gang Ryang and the Dragon Corps, turned her gaze back to Yeon Ho-Jeong.

At that moment, Yeon Ho-Jeong spoke.

“You’ve died once.”

“…?”

“The moment you turned your head, you had already died once by my hand.”

“I know you don’t intend to kill me.”

“Even if I don’t intend to kill, if I must, I will.”

They had never met before, yet they were having such a brutal conversation.

It was an even more tense situation than when they had faced the Divine Cult Leader, Gi Cheon-Woong. For those who knew Yeon Ho-Jeong, the current situation would be hard to understand.

Mo Ja-Seon’s eyes deepened.

“So, do you want to fight?”

“Depending on your answer, I might.”

“This is an interesting situation. I had something I wanted to ask you when we met. It seems you were the same.”

“Someone once said that life is interesting because it’s full of unpredictable fun.”

Mo Ja-Seon, who had been silently watching Yeon Ho-Jeong, spoke again after half a beat.

“On my way here, I tried some tea from the mainland. It was somewhat exotic and strong, but it was quite drinkable.”

“……”

“If we have no particular grievances against each other, could I be treated to a good cup of tea?”

“You seem confident.”

“Ask what you want to ask.”

Yeon Ho-Jeong asked directly.

“Why do you use the surname Mo?”

“……”

“I know your surname is different.”

Confusion arose on Gang Ryang’s face.

Her surname was different? Then, was Mo Ja-Seon not a Mo?

Mo Ja-Seon spoke in her usual blunt tone.

“All the high-ranking members of the Ice Palace use the surname Mo.”

“The question is whether you are truly a member of the bloodline.”

It was an unusual statement.

“Or does the Ice Palace use the term ‘bloodline’ even if there is no blood relation?”

“That is correct.”

She answered confidently.

Yeon Ho-Jeong was quite surprised by Mo Ja-Seon’s honest answer.

‘She knows.’

The moment he asked about her surname, Mo Ja-Seon had guessed. She knew that her opponent was aware of her true identity.

Yet, she didn’t beat around the bush and answered honestly and truthfully.

“What was your surname before you became a member of the bloodline?”

“I do not know.”

“Are you avoiding the answer?”

“I truly do not know, so that is why. However, I have one question for you as well. Does my answer hold such great significance for you?”

“It’s not just me.”

Yeon Ho-Jeong’s calm voice became sticky.

The pleasant voice began to smell of blood. It was as if the person had changed in an instant.

“It’s not just for me, but for everyone living in the Central Plains. If you didn’t come here to play word games with me, you must know the significance of this.”

“……”

“We are currently fighting an unprecedented enemy. If a full-scale war breaks out with them, an immeasurable number of lives will be lost.”

“I suppose so.”

“We carry those countless lives on our backs, and we live on. If the leader of an organization doesn’t know that we have no choice but to be on edge, then you are not qualified to lead the Ice Palace.”

Mo Ja-Seon’s eyes narrowed.

A bitter look flashed across her eyes.

“Yes. From the start, I never wanted to become the Palace Lord.”

“I don’t care what your story is. I answered your question, so don’t avoid answering this time.”

“……”

“What is your original surname?”

“My answer is the same. I truly do not know. I was not properly given my surname.”

Whoooosh.

A faint golden aura pulsed from Yeon Ho-Jeong’s Black Dragon Hand Axe.

There was no need for further discussion. Yeon Ho-Jeong was truly prepared to blow Mo Ja-Seon’s head off.

At that moment, Mo Ja-Seon opened her mouth.

“However, if you insist on mentioning a surname… to some, it might be considered Cheon.”

Gang Ryang’s eyes flashed.

Cheon.

Having heard about Shinma-rim [Demonic Realm] and the Blood Demon Cult from Yeon Ho-Jeong, he knew about the hidden story behind the Cheon surname.

Whoooosh.

The golden dragon energy that had been swirling around the Black Dragon Hand Axe subsided.

“Explain in detail.”

“It’s just an old story from the past. It’s not something I want to talk about where everyone can hear.”

“……”

“Wasn’t what you wanted to know what my surname was before I used the Mo surname?”

“Don’t just skim the surface of the question.”

Yeon Ho-Jeong continued with a stern face.

“I am asking if you are a member of the Blood Demon Cult.”

The letter that Hwa Jin-Cheon had given him contained one piece of information.

That the current Palace Lord, the woman known as the Ice Demon King, was likely the illegitimate child of the former Blood Demon Cult leader.

The moniker of Ice Demon King was also a nickname given to her because of her ruthless methods, which were unlike those of the Ice Palace. Everyone had feared her for her distinctly different methods and decisiveness compared to the previous Ice Palace Lords.

However, after the reign had stabilized, her uniquely sharp and decisive rule was recognized by many in the Ice Palace.

Northern Sea Demon Queen.

That was the real nickname given to Mo Ja-Seon during her terrifying purge.

Mo Ja-Seon’s eyes deepened.

“I have never once considered myself a member of the Blood Demon Cult.”

“……”

“However, it is true that the blood of a mad demon flows in my veins.”

“According to reliable intelligence organizations, I heard that you were taken to the Ice Palace in your mid-teens and trained under their protection.”

“Protection? More like breeding.”

For the first time, a strong emotion was felt in her blunt voice.

It was anger.

Even though she was over fifty and nearing sixty, her anger was vivid. As if she were dealing with something that had just happened, her anger was hot and full of life.

Yeon Ho-Jeong asked inwardly.

‘Is it true?’

Who was he asking?

Surprisingly, an answer to that question came.

‘It is true.’

The anger that Mo Ja-Seon was showing was transparent. A strong anger towards the Ice Palace was felt.

However, Yeon Ho-Jeong was focused on the Blood Demon Cult.

In Mo Ja-Seon’s statement that the blood of a mad demon flowed in her veins, there was a strong sense of disgust that was no less than the anger that followed.

Yeon Ho-Jeong opened his mouth.

“I heard that the reason you led your people here was not because you were afraid of death, but because you didn’t want to live a life of humiliation.”

“……”

“That’s not something you can easily say without knowing them well. You must have known a lot about the Blood Demon Cult.”

Mo Ja-Seon did not answer.

“Answer one more thing.”

Yeon Ho-Jeong pointed the Black Dragon Hand Axe at Mo Ja-Seon’s neck.

“Show me proof that you are not a pawn of the Blood Demon Cult. If that proof is confirmed, the Martial Alliance might not, but the Black Emperor Castle will welcome you as a guest.”
